Output 99216320da8f254a38d3cebfcc278fae5afba1eea557825a1ca602dcdb9b6ea6:0

value
76556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e4f5fef8a0ba43921ebf9e7a07f0adb90b9127f OP_EQUAL
address
3G85mua47pBAsRA5ecQ7s6rhtoBLpvJ6v6
transaction
99216320da8f254a38d3cebfcc278fae5afba1eea557825a1ca602dcdb9b6ea6
confirmations
24868
spent
true